Product Overview
The Epro PR6423/001-011-CN 8 mm Eddy-Current Sensor is a precision proximity probe designed for accurate non-contact measurement of shaft vibration, displacement, and position in rotating machinery. As part of the PR6423 series, the CN version is tailored for compatibility with specific monitoring environments, ensuring reliable integration into localized systems. With robust construction and high thermal stability, it is ideal for use in demanding industrial conditions.

Technical Specifications
| Item | Specification |
|---|---|
| Manufacturer | Epro (by Emerson / Brüel & Kjær Vibro) |
| Model Number | PR6423/001-011-CN |
| Sensor Type | Eddy-Current Proximity Sensor |
| Tip Diameter | 8 mm |
| Measurement Range | Up to 2 mm (typical with CON driver) |
| Sensitivity | 7.87 mV/µm (200 mV/mil) |
| Frequency Range | DC to 10 kHz |
| Linearity | ±1% of full scale |
| Operating Temperature | -35 °C to +180 °C |
| Storage Temperature | -40 °C to +200 °C |
| Dimensions | Sensor head diameter 8 mm |
| Weight | 0.22 kg |
